Summary: This is the classic work about improving creativity from world-renowned writer and philosopher Edward de Bono. In schools, we are taught to meet problems head-on: what Edward de Bono calls 'vertical thinking'. This works well in simple situations — but we are at a loss when this approach fails. What then? Lateral thinking is all about freeing up your imagination. Through a series of special techniques, in groups or working alone, Edward de Bono shows how to stimulate the mind in new and exciting ways. Soon you will be looking at problems from a variety of angles and offering up solutions that are as ingenious as they are effective. You will become much more productive and a formidable thinker in your own right.
